By a unanimous vote, the Fargo Park District has decided to allow same-sex couples and single-parent households a discount when purchasing season passes to fargo public golf courses.
The decision drops the "Family" discount distinction and introduces a new household designation, allowing some non-traditional families the same rate as married heterosexual couples.
The issue came to light when a lesbian couple was denied a family pass.
The park district admitted that it dropped the ball by excluding same sex couples and single parent households from its discount category.
Commissioners in attendance acknowledged that the controversy over the family pass provided a well-needed wake-up call to the policy.
